Today the talk of being grounded has a different meaning.
Grounded means being present, centered and balanced in your own body. Being connected to the earth with feet firmly planted. Reining in all the pieces pulling you in all directions so you can find the balance to deal with things from your center inside of being on the merry-go-round. Having that solid center of you and starting there can help you deal with the spinning.
You can take a break from your day and take a breather. Go to a quiet place and shut a door if you can. Sit in a chair and get comfortable and have your feet firmly planted on the ground. Close your eyes and take several deep slow breaths. Imagine a silken cord, silver or gold or whatever color appeals to you, coming down from the top of your head and down through your body. Slow yourself down and imagine that cord sinking down into the earth through soil and rock until it reaches the earth’s core. Now hook yourself into the center of earth and feel yourself anchored there, balanced and connected.
You can also imagine yourself growing roots like a tree. Your roots are snaking all the way down to the earth’s core. They hold you steadfast and rooted to the earth no matter when winds blow and bend you in any direction.
Just as that tree remains unwavering, you in your center can remain still when all of life blows around you. You are in your own skin and centered.
